gpt4 book ai didi

iphone - 在 Xcode 中组织不同版本的应用程序

转载 作者:行者123 更新时间:2023-11-29 11:06:42 25 4
gpt4 key购买 nike

我正在开发一个可以编辑图像的 iPhone 应用程序。最终,我想要一个允许用户简单地编辑他们的图像的小版本,以及一个允许图像社交网络的大版本。然后我想为 iPad 开发一个版本。

由于这是我第一次涉足商业移动开发,我对如何在 Xcode 中组织所有这些版本感到困惑。显然,每个版本之间将共享文件重用。我想我的问题是,如何以最有效的方式组织这些单独的项目,以便它们共享文件,因此当我编辑共享的特定文件时,对应用程序的每个版本进行更改? XCode 中是否有某种构造要遵循?

是否有关于如何执行此操作的任何链接或文献? (不确定搜索它的正确术语)。

最佳答案

记住:如果您发现自己在重复/复制某些内容,请怀疑您做错了。

在这种情况下,您的 Xcode 项目将有 4 个目标。此设置的基本目标布局如下所示:

  • 静态库(用于共享源文件)
  • 资源包(用于您的共享资源)
  • App-Full(通用)
  • App-Lite(通用)

应用程序链接到共享静态库,并复制资源包。

自然地,应用程序将具有不同的源/库/依赖项——它们位于应用程序目标(或其他一些依赖项)中。

鉴于您的背景:计划花大量时间(最初和以后)和耐心来弄清楚这些依赖项应该如何组成、使用和维护。

关于iphone - 在 Xcode 中组织不同版本的应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13277464/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com